Gel-casting is a novel forming process of PLCT pyroelectric material combining innoxious gel-casting with PLCT pyroelectric material, and there is few report about this aspect in china. Gel-casting used in the paper is an in-situ forming process in which slurry of ceramic powder which uses the condensation of orthosilicic acid in slurry of ceramic is cast. The process is a promising technique for complex shapes of ceramic materials with high ingredient uniformity and high reliability of performance. Gel-cast green bodies are strong and machinable.The technological character, conditions and affecting factors are discussed in the paper. The paper attaches importance to prepare high-grade hydrolysis liquid to redu- cing the viscosity of volume, the effects of PH value, temperature, ethanol content and the method of mixing on the quality of hydrolysis liquid are investigated. At the same time, the research is done in sintering temperature and rate of heating-up, and the PLCT pyroelectric material which the performance is better than that made by trad- itional technology is prepared. With this method the thick film is prepared by technology of tape-casting. The technology of drying and sintering is invented through the research on technology of tape-casting and the new formulation on configuration of hydrolysis liquid. The perform- ance of PLCT thick film made through plywood-faced sintering method is good. The results show that,in the range of temperature measured, the PLCT pyroelectric cera- mics sample made by gel-casting, which pyroelectric coefficient and detectivity figure-of-merits are 8.0×10-4C/m2K, and 9.87×10-5Pa-1/2 respectively, and pyroelectric coefficient and detectivity figure-of-merits of the PLCT pyroelectric thick film sample are 3.0×10-4C/m2K, and 2.016×10-5Pa-1/2.The previous performance indicates that gel-casting has the extremely attractive prospect on the development and application of the pyroelectric materials and devices.
